Kurs-ID: JavaXML
Kurs WebServices mit Java und der Enterprise Edition
(JEE) Messageorientierte Middelware (MOM)
Nach dem Besuch dieses WebServices-Seminars sind Sie in der Lage, Java-Anwendungen um Web Services und Web Service Clients zu erweitern und Web Services in verschiedenen Szenarien anzuwenden. Sie kennen Architekturen für die nahtlose Einbindung von Web Services in bestehende Anwendungen und für die Neuentwicklung. Sie kennen zudem Lösungsstrategien für Probleme der Interoperabilität und Performancesteigerung.
Die nötigen Grundlagen in Java, JEE, XML und Web Technologien werden Ihnen in diesem Kurs vermittelt. Dabei wird auf den Kenntnisstand der Teilnehmenden eingegangen. In einem geführten Abschlussprojekt wird eine vollständige Beispielanwendung mit Web Services entwickelt, auf Wunsch mit Datenbankanbindung.
Seminarinhalte
Grundlagen
- XML, XML-Schema und XML-Verarbeitung mit Java
- JAXB, JEE Grundlagen und HTTP
Web Service Definition
- Schnittstellenbeschreibung mit WSDL
- Die Messagestyles: RPC/Encoded, RPC/Literal, Document/Literal, Wrapped und Bare
- SOAP over HTTP, Aufbau von SOAP-Nachrichten und SOAP-Monitoring
- Message Exchange Pattern
- Synchrone und asynchrone Web Services
- Interoperabilität
Web Service Programmierung mit Java
- JAX-WS Programmiermodell mit Java POJOs (Plain Old Java Objects) und Annotationen
- Vorgehensmodelle und deren Anwendung: Code First vs. Contract First (inkl. toolgestütztes Erstellen von WSDL-Dokumenten)
- SOAP With Attachments API for Java (SAAJ)
- JAX-Ws Handler-Framework
- Web Services in der Java Enterprise Edition: Vom Prototyp zur vollwertigen Enterprise-Anwendung
- Fehlerbehandlung
- RESTful Web Services mit JAX-RS
- IDE/Tools-Unterstützung
- Sichern von Web Services
- Performance-Optimierungen
- WS-* Standards
Web Service Architekturen in der Praxis
- Benutzung von Design Pattern wie Facade und Business Delegate mit Web Services in JEE-Architekturen
- Umwandeln von monolithischen Java SE Anwendungen
- Verteilung von JEE Anwendungen mit Web Services.
- Weitere Frameworks: Axis2, CXF
Kursthemen
Das Training WebServices mit Java und der Enterprise Edition ist folgenden Themen zugeordnet:
Zusatzangebote zur Schulung WebServices mit Java und der Enterprise Edition
Practice-AddOn ist ein Beratungskontingent, das Sie zusammen mit Ihrem Schulungspaket buchen können. Jetzt informieren.
Lernmethode
Ausgewogene Mischung aus Theorie und praktischen Übungen in technisch einwandfreier Schulungsumgebung, zur Festigung Ihres Lernerfolges. Direkter Austausch mit Trainer.in und anderen Teilnehmenden.
Zielgruppe
Diese Schulung richtet sich an Projektleiter, Anwendungsprogrammierer, Systemprogrammierer, Softwareingenieure, Internet-, Intranetentwickler und Webprogrammierer
Voraussetzungen
Für diesen Kurs benötigen Sie: Solide Kenntnisse in der objektorientierten Programmierung (OOP) mit Java im Niveau unseres Grundlagenkurses. Empfehlenswert für diese Java-Schulung sind XML-Vorkenntnisse, da XML an sich sehr kompakt behandelt wird, andernfalls ist der Besuch des Kurses XML sinnvoll.
Erforderliche Kenntnisse
Gewünschte Kenntnisse
Dauer und Zeiten
3 Kurstage (pro Tag 8 Unterrichtsstunden à 45 Min.)
In der Regel beginnt ein Schulungstag um 09:00 Uhr und endet um 16:30 Uhr.
Weiterführende Seminare
Schulungsort
Das Seminar WebServices mit Java und der Enterprise Edition als offene Schulung findet bei uns in der Kastanienallee 53 in 10119 Berlin Mitte statt, sofern kein anderer Ort angegeben ist.
Termine
Terminabsprachen möglich! Buchen Sie diesen Kurs als Individualtraining oder Firmenkurs mit individueller Dauer und gewünschtem Termin. (Preisänderungen vorbehalten)
Anfrage stellenDie Schulung WebServices mit Java und der Enterprise Edition führen wir ab 3 Teilnehmenden durch.
Kurspreis für offene Schulungen
1215,00 € zzgl. 19% MwSt. (1445,85 € inkl. 19% MwSt.)
Hinweis
Dieses WebServices-Seminar kann als IT-Training für Firmen auch in englischer Sprache durchgeführt werden.
Ihre allskills Mehrwerte inklusive
- Kostenlose Schnuppersession
- Preisvorteil 3=5
- Anmeldezugabe
- Vollverpflegung bei offenen Seminaren
- Schulungsunterlage oder Fachbuch falls verfügbar
- Arbeitsmaterialen: Block und Stift
- Teilnahmezertifikat (auch optional als validierbare Online-Version)
- Erfolgsgarantie
- Nachbetreuung